    Why is Krill Oil better than Fish Oil?

    Essential fatty acids in the form of EPA and DHA are contained in both Krill Oil and fish oil. Krill Oil has the benefit of a higher bioavailability than fish oil, which allows your body to use the essential EPA and DHA faster. The polyunsaturated fats in Krill Oil are stored in phospholipids while fish oil has them in triglycerides. Our body must undergo additional processing to access and use the EPA and DHA found in triglyceride, while phospholipids are absorbed without further processing. Krill Oil also contains the antioxidant astaxanthin, whereas fish oil does not. Krill Oil is also regarded as safer.

    What are the benefits of Astaxanthin found in Krill Oil?

    Astaxanthin is a super-antioxidant present in Krill Oil. Microalgae in the ocean produce high levels of astaxanthin that are then ingested by the krill, giving them the pinkish coloring. Astaxanthin is a keto-carotenoid, like beta-carotene and lycopene, and is thought to be much more powerful than other carotenoids. Astaxanthin has several health benefits, including joint health by acting as a natural anti-inflammatory. It may also help improve your skin, vision, energy, immune, cardiovascular, and brain function. Fish oil does not contain astaxanthin, which is a critical difference between the two.

    Why is Krill Oil safer than fish oil?

    High levels of harmful mercury and PCBs (polychlorinated biphenyls) are found in our oceans. A growing concern with fish oil is that it is often extracted from larger fish who are higher up the food chain and have eaten smaller fish. The more variety of smaller fish the larger fish eat, the higher the levels of harmful mercury and PCBs that are also consumed. This, in turn, can then be harmful as we consume the fish oil. Stonehenge Health Antarctic Krill Oil Complex is sourced from the Antarctic Ocean as the name suggests, which has notably cleaner, less polluted water that other more frequently fished oceans. Krill have a short lifespan and thus less time to build up mercury and PCBs levels compared to the larger fish varieties that are harvested for fish oil. Krill only eat algae and don’t eat other types of fish. These aspects make Krill Oil safer to use and a more effective alternative to using fish oil.
